I am trying now for several days to import a certificate, to process it in my C++ code. What am I doing wrong? Here are the steps I perform in my code:
I initiate with gnutls_global_init();
I get a FILE-type opject into my programm, using fopen and fread
I save the FILE-type obejct containing the certificate and the length of the FILE-type into a gnutls_datum_t-type object (loaded_file)
I init a gnutls certificate with gnutls_x509_crt_init(&cert)
I use gnutls_x509_crt_import(cert, &loaded_file, GNUTLS_X509_FMT_PEM)
I get the error code -207: Base64 unexpected header error...what does this mean?
when I want to print the certificate information using gnutls_x509_crt_print() I get the following information:
